Output a8ea175537838a5dca5df0717c3271e7f6ffa07df9198a81b99fd9090d168cb6:13

value
20000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b3880341676c2ce149dc5e6ec6ff517b8b1c0e8a OP_EQUAL
address
3J4HpDApi1VXxdmQRToG8ZHkccra575aJy
transaction
a8ea175537838a5dca5df0717c3271e7f6ffa07df9198a81b99fd9090d168cb6
confirmations
265422
spent
true